Privacy and Security Concerns in the IoT Landscape

How can users safeguard their personal information in a landscape increasingly dominated by IoT devices?

Implementing robust security protocols, including device authentication and encryption methods, is crucial.

Users must actively engage with privacy policies and ensure informed user consent.

The Future of Connectivity: Trends and Innovations in IoT

While the Internet of Things (IoT) continually evolves, it is essential to recognize the significant trends and innovations shaping its future.

Smart cities are emerging through enhanced connectivity, utilizing edge computing to process data closer to devices, thereby reducing latency.

This shift enables real-time decision-making, fostering a more efficient and responsive urban environment, ultimately enhancing individual freedom and quality of life.
